SPECTROPHOTOMETER MENU OPTIONS
SECTION 5 – Photometrics

The photometrics measurement mode enables simple measurements of absorbance and % transmittance
to be performed. The sample is measured at one wavelength and at one point in time. There are no post
measurement calculations available in this measurement mode.

5.2

METHOD SET UP

This measurement mode is very simple and the only
parameters which can be adjusted are the wavelength and
the display format.

The toggle icon enables the large primary display to be set
to show the absorbance or % transmittance.
To change the primary and secondary displays press the
key adjacent to the toggle icon. Repeat presses will cycle
the display between absorbance and % transmittance.

5.2.1 Selecting a Wavelength

The wavelength can be adjusted by using the keys adjacent to the arrow icons to increase or decrease
the wavelength. Once the required wavelength has been selected a calibration can be performed.
